  • Abstract
    IEEE Women in Engineering (WIE) has extended its hand to reach out to groups that are below the radar for a long time?groups that are intellectual, diverse, dynamic, creative, and persevering yet often quietly present in a field that is just as diverse and dynamic as the groups that struggle to maintain their presence and be heard?groups such as the female engineering and computer science undergraduate students at Alabama A&M University (AAMU) on ?The Hill? in Huntsville, Alabama. WIE set its sights to collaborate with the group at AAMU as part of promoting and seeking out the diverse talents of more underrepresented groups in the area. Although the female students that represent electrical engineering and computer science are small in number at AAMU, their interests, ideals, and voice to promote the engineering program at AAMU as they aspire to join the global world of engineering is bold, vibrant, and substantient.
